From: cajus Date: Fri, 14 Mar 2008 14:25:13 +0000 (+0000) Subject: Added logrotate for server and client X-Git-Url: https://git.tokkee.org/?a=commitdiff_plain;h=34a0de8124ec9b6c9e08fa7e68ff98a042dacccd;p=gosa.git Added logrotate for server and client git-svn-id: https://oss.gonicus.de/repositories/gosa/trunk@9865 594d385d-05f5-0310-b6e9-bd551577e9d8 --- diff --git a/gosa-si/debian/gosa-si-client.logrotate b/gosa-si/debian/gosa-si-client.logrotate new file mode 100644 index 000000000..7e9fd81e3 --- /dev/null +++ b/gosa-si/debian/gosa-si-client.logrotate @@ -0,0 +1,10 @@ +/var/log/gosa-si-client.log { + weekly + rotate 4 + compress + missingok + postrotate + pkill -SIGUSR1 gosa-si-client > /dev/null || true + endscript +} + diff --git a/gosa-si/debian/gosa-si-server.logrotate b/gosa-si/debian/gosa-si-server.logrotate new file mode 100644 index 000000000..c10f95e34 --- /dev/null +++ b/gosa-si/debian/gosa-si-server.logrotate @@ -0,0 +1,10 @@ +/var/log/gosa-si-server.log { + weekly + rotate 4 + compress + missingok + postrotate + pkill -SIGUSR1 gosa-si-server > /dev/null || true + endscript +} + diff --git a/gosa-si/debian/rules b/gosa-si/debian/rules index 607349c89..2354826af 100755 --- a/gosa-si/debian/rules +++ b/gosa-si/debian/rules @@ -59,6 +59,7 @@ binary-indep: install dh_installcron dh_installexamples dh_installchangelogs + dh_installlogrotate #dh_installdebconf dh_installinit --init-script=gosa-si -- start 00 2 3 4 5 . stop 29 1 .